| Small swarm near Lake Temescal. Great if you need a queen but don’t want a full colony. Pretty sure it is from a hive I have a couple houses down which is a super productive even keeled colony. I collected a swarm from this location a couple days ago and suspected there were multiple queens, which makes sense since this clump of bees has been there since last weekend.
